Stunning announcement: A serial killer who died more than a decade ago is the person who decapitated the 6-year-old son of "America's Most Wanted" host John Walsh in 1981, police in Florida said Tuesday.. The book now closed on the Walsh killing.. .. the case that inspired AMERICA'S MOST WANTED.. This is a photo of Ottis Toole..

    schmuck -shmuhk-
    a noun Slang. an obnoxious or contemptible person.
    Origin:
    1890-95; Yiddish shmok (vulgar) lit., penis of uncert. orig.

    MUCKRAKER: A muckraker seeks to expose corruption of businesses or government to the public
    Origin:
    Theodore Roosevelt used the term muckrake in a 1906 speech in which he agreed with the accusations of muckrakers, but questioned their methods
